I fasted all day without a problem, but since it did come so easy, does that mean I should be doing more? Like, say, fasting for three days? I was under the impression that when fasting, you are supposed to undergo some sort of suffering in order to become more connected with God, but I really experienced no such suffering.

It boils down to an interaction between you and God on whether you are doing enough. You have only done it once. Don't expect it to always to be so easy. It really is the comittment and purpose that is to be emphasized.

Did you fast only with water or did you have some foods? I don't have much trouble with one day fasts with water only. I don't worry about how easy it is. My concern is always purpose and pleasing my Lord.

Note: Suffering for suffering sake is not Biblical. Worship is not based upon how easy something is: it is always purpose. Perhaps you have a strong spiritual state that makes it easy. If that is the case, maybe a prolonged fast is what you need. I know I seem to be contradicting myself, but there is no simple answer but to evaluate matters with God.

Fasting is not something you do to torture yourself, or something you do to attract God's admiration.

Fasting is giving up something for the sake of being better able to hear the voice of God. It is an act of discipline and worship. It is not a self-flagelation to make yourself suffer to bring you purity or anything else.

If you are doing it to make yourself suffer, you are doing it for the wrong reason.

Just to point out, today is a fast day. The purpose of this fast is to remember Christ's betrayal at the hands of Judas and to pray that we don't follow the same path.

An Orthodox fast is one of no meat, no dairy (including eggs), no wine and no olive oil.

Fasting should only be done under the guidance of one's spiritual father so as not to lead to temptation.

Sacrifice something that means much to you. For example, I love chocolate and have some just about every day. Therefore, fasting for me would be to not have any chocolate for an amount of time. I would do this to show God and myself how much He means to me. By sacrificing something of great significance to me, I would be showing God my love and trust for Him. This would also keep my focus on Him, since every time I would think of chocolate, I would remind myself why I will not have any at that time.
